[<a href=\"https:\/\/www.minejxsc.com\/blog\/what-is-magnetic-seperation\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">minejxsc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img fetchpriority=\"high\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"1581\" height=\"891\" src=\"https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014485923.jpg\" alt=\"Magnet Types Overview\" class=\"wp-image-3066\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014485923.jpg 1581w, https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014485923-18x10.jpg 18w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1581px) 100vw, 1581px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"Understanding-Magnet-Types-in-Industrial-Processing\"><\/a><strong>Understanding Magnet Types in Industrial Processing<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>In industrial practice, we usually talk about three functional categories of magnets: <strong>temporary magnets<\/strong>, <strong>permanent magnets<\/strong>, and <strong>electromagnets used as controllable &#8220;temporary&#8221; magnets<\/strong>. Each behaves differently in a magnetic separator or process line, even if the physics behind them is the same.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\">greatmagtech<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Temporary magnets<\/strong>: Materials like mild steel that only become magnetized in an external magnetic field and lose magnetism once that field is removed.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Permanent magnets<\/strong>: Materials (such as ferrite and rare\u2011earth magnets) that maintain a strong magnetic field without any external power source.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Electromagnets<\/strong>: Coils energized with current, often around a ferromagnetic core, that act as powerful, switchable temporary magnets.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\">greatmagtech<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>In separation equipment, all three concepts show up: permanent magnetic separators, electromagnetic separators, and hybrid designs tailored to different products and particle sizes.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.minejxsc.com\/blog\/what-is-magnetic-seperation\/\" target=\"_blank\">minejxsc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"What-Is-Temporary-Magnetism?\"><\/a><strong>What Is Temporary Magnetism?<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Temporary magnetism describes materials that <strong>only hold magnetism while they are under the influence of an external magnetic field<\/strong>. Once you remove that field, the internal magnetic domains fall back into a random state and the part becomes effectively non\u2011magnetic again.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"Materials-and-behavior\"><\/a><strong>Materials and behavior<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; Typical <strong>temporary magnetic materials<\/strong>: low\u2011carbon steels and other soft ferromagnetic alloys based on iron, nickel, and cobalt.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; They show <strong>low coercivity and low remanence<\/strong>, meaning they are easy to magnetize and just as easy to demagnetize.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Engineers like temporary magnetism because it gives <strong>precise control<\/strong>: you can turn the field &#8220;on&#8221; and &#8220;off&#8221; simply by energizing or de\u2011energizing an electromagnet.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\">greatmagtech<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"Industrial-Uses-of-Temporary-Magnets-and-Electromagnets\"><\/a><strong>Industrial Uses of Temporary Magnets and Electromagnets<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>From an industrial point of view, we almost always encounter temporary magnetism through <strong>electromagnets<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"1.-Electromagnetic-separators-in-slurries-and-powders\"><\/a><strong>1. Electromagnetic separators in slurries and powders<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Wet drum and slurry\u2011type electromagnetic separators use coils to create a strong, controllable field inside a rotating drum or over a flow channel. These are widely used in: [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.imt-inc.com\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-explained\/\" target=\"_blank\">imt-inc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Mining and mineral processing<\/strong> (e.g., iron ore upgrading, ilmenite recovery). [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.imt-inc.com\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-explained\/\" target=\"_blank\">imt-inc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Ceramics and glass<\/strong> (removing iron impurities from kaolin, quartz, feldspar). [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/experts.umn.edu\/en\/publications\/particle-flow-modeling-of-dry-induced-roll-magnetic-separator\/\" target=\"_blank\">experts.umn<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Battery cathode\/anode materials<\/strong> (fine iron removal to protect downstream equipment and product performance).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Because the magnet is temporary, operators can <strong>adjust current, field strength, and duty cycle<\/strong> in real time to match product changes.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\">greatmagtech<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"What-Is-a-Permanent-Magnet?\"><\/a><strong>What Is a Permanent Magnet?<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>A <strong>permanent magnet<\/strong> is a material where the magnetic domains are locked into a mostly aligned state, so the magnet keeps its field without any external power. Common industrial permanent magnet families include: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Ferrite (ceramic) magnets<\/strong> \u2013 cost\u2011effective, corrosion\u2011resistant, moderate strength.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Alnico magnets<\/strong> \u2013 high temperature stability but lower coercivity compared with rare\u2011earth magnets.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Rare\u2011earth magnets<\/strong> such as <strong>NdFeB (neodymium)<\/strong> and <strong>SmCo (samarium\u2013cobalt)<\/strong> \u2013 very high energy product and coercivity.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>In powder and bulk handling, rare\u2011earth permanent magnets let you build <strong>compact, high\u2011intensity separators<\/strong> that can pull weakly magnetic contaminants from fine powders at very high throughput.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/experts.umn.edu\/en\/publications\/particle-flow-modeling-of-dry-induced-roll-magnetic-separator\/\" target=\"_blank\">experts.umn<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img decoding=\"async\" width=\"1581\" height=\"891\" src=\"https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014492121.jpg\" alt=\"Inside A Powder Magnetic Separator1\" class=\"wp-image-3067\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014492121.jpg 1581w, https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014492121-18x10.jpg 18w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1581px) 100vw, 1581px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"How-Permanent-Magnets-Work-in-Separators\"><\/a><strong>How Permanent Magnets Work in Separators<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Permanent magnetic separators use static magnetic circuits (often multi\u2011pole) to generate an intense field in the working zone where powder or slurry passes.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.minejxsc.com\/blog\/what-is-magnetic-seperation\/\" target=\"_blank\">minejxsc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Typical permanent\u2011magnet process equipment includes: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Powder magnetic separators<\/strong> (gravity or pneumatic inline types) for ceramics, glass, plastics, food powders, and battery materials.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Drawer magnets and grids<\/strong> in dry powder transfer lines.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.magnattackglobal.com\/blog\/bakery-magnet-guide\/\" target=\"_blank\">magnattackglobal<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Drum and roller separators<\/strong> for dry mineral sands, plastics regrind, and e\u2011scrap.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/experts.umn.edu\/en\/publications\/particle-flow-modeling-of-dry-induced-roll-magnetic-separator\/\" target=\"_blank\">experts.umn<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Because there is no coil, these machines deliver <strong>constant field strength with zero operating energy consumption<\/strong>, aside from motors and automation systems.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.minejxsc.com\/blog\/what-is-magnetic-seperation\/\" target=\"_blank\">minejxsc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"Key-Differences:-Temporary-vs-Permanent-Magnets-in-Practice\"><\/a><strong>Key Differences: Temporary vs Permanent Magnets in Practice<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>From an engineering view, the &#8220;right&#8221; magnet is rarely the strongest one\u2014it is the one that best fits your <strong>process constraints<\/strong> (temperature, throughput, cleaning method, energy, safety, and budget). [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.minejxsc.com\/blog\/what-is-magnetic-seperation\/\" target=\"_blank\">minejxsc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"Side\u2011by\u2011side-comparison\"><\/a><strong>Side\u2011by\u2011side comparison<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-table\"><table class=\"has-fixed-layout\"><thead><tr><th>Aspect<\/th><th>Temporary \/ Electromagnet<\/th><th>Permanent Magnet<\/th><\/tr><\/thead><tbody><tr><td>Magnetization source<\/td><td>Needs external current and field <a href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">greatmagtech<\/a><\/td><td>Built\u2011in aligned domains, self\u2011sustaining<\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Coercivity &amp; remanence<\/td><td>Low \u2013 easy to magnetize and demagnetize<\/td><td>High \u2013 strongly resists demagnetization<\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Field control<\/td><td>Field can be switched and tuned via current <a href=\"https:\/\/www.imt-inc.com\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-explained\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">imt-inc<\/a><\/td><td>Fixed field; only mechanical adjustments possible<\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Operating energy use<\/td><td>Continuous power draw, may need cooling <a href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">greatmagtech<\/a><\/td><td>No energy for the magnetic field itself <a href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">greatmagtech<\/a><\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Typical separator uses<\/td><td>Wet drums, high\u2011gradient slurries, lifting, MRI <a href=\"https:\/\/www.imt-inc.com\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-explained\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">imt-inc<\/a><\/td><td>Powder separators, drawer magnets, dry drums <a href=\"https:\/\/www.magnattackglobal.com\/blog\/bakery-magnet-guide\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">magnattackglobal<\/a><\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Cost profile<\/td><td>Higher CapEx and OpEx; complex controls <a href=\"https:\/\/www.gme-magnet.com\/info\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-trends-insights-102868358.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">gme-magnet<\/a><\/td><td>Lower operating cost; rare\u2011earth materials can raise CapEx <a href=\"https:\/\/www.gme-magnet.com\/info\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-trends-insights-102868358.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">gme-magnet<\/a><\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Environmental impact<\/td><td>Related to energy use; recyclable steel cores <a href=\"https:\/\/www.gme-magnet.com\/info\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-trends-insights-102868358.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">gme-magnet<\/a><\/td><td>Mining and refining of rare\u2011earths have higher environmental footprint if not managed responsibly<\/td><\/tr><\/tbody><\/table><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p>In modern processing plants, the most robust systems <strong>combine both types<\/strong>: permanent magnets for baseline protection and energy\u2011efficient separation, and electromagnets where controllability and extreme field gradients are required.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.imt-inc.com\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-explained\/\" target=\"_blank\">imt-inc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"1.-Ceramics,-glass,-and-building-materials\"><\/a><strong>1. Ceramics, glass, and building materials<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Challenge<\/strong>: Remove iron contamination from quartz, feldspar, kaolin, and glass batch to achieve high whiteness and low Fe content.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/experts.umn.edu\/en\/publications\/particle-flow-modeling-of-dry-induced-roll-magnetic-separator\/\" target=\"_blank\">experts.umn<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Best fit<\/strong>: High\u2011intensity <strong>permanent powder separators<\/strong> for dry phases; <strong>wet electromagnetic separators<\/strong> for slurries where ultra\u2011low residual iron is required.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.imt-inc.com\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-explained\/\" target=\"_blank\">imt-inc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Why<\/strong>: Permanent magnets protect day\u2011to\u2011day production economically, while electromagnets provide deep cleaning for premium grades.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"2.-Mining-and-mineral-processing\"><\/a><strong>2. Mining and mineral processing<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Challenge<\/strong>: Recover valuable magnetic minerals and protect crushers, mills, and screens from tramp iron.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.gme-magnet.com\/info\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-trends-insights-102868358.html\" target=\"_blank\">gme-magnet<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Best fit<\/strong>: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; Over\u2011belt <strong>electromagnets<\/strong> or powerful permanent cross\u2011belt magnets for tramp iron.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Wet drum electromagnetic separators<\/strong> in concentration stages.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.gme-magnet.com\/info\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-trends-insights-102868358.html\" target=\"_blank\">gme-magnet<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Why<\/strong>: Temporary magnetism allows high\u2011throughput slurry processing with adjustable field strength and automatic discharge.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"3.-Food,-rubber,-and-plastics\"><\/a><strong>3. Food, rubber, and plastics<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Challenge<\/strong>: Metal contamination threatens consumer safety, regulatory compliance, and equipment life.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/mainrichmagnets.com\/industrial-magnets\" target=\"_blank\">mainrichmagnets<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Best fit<\/strong>: Rare\u2011earth <strong>permanent grid, trap, and bullet magnets<\/strong> in gravity lines and pneumatic conveying; in some liquid systems, self\u2011cleaning designs with magnet bars that can be pneumatically withdrawn.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/mainrichmagnets.com\/industrial-magnets\" target=\"_blank\">mainrichmagnets<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Why<\/strong>: Permanent magnets provide continuous protection with no risk of line\u2011stopping in case of power dips.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"4.-Battery-cathode\/anode-and-advanced-materials\"><\/a><strong>4. Battery cathode\/anode and advanced materials<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Challenge<\/strong>: Ultra\u2011fine powders with strict impurity limits; any iron particle can damage performance or cause safety issues.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8211; <strong>Best fit<\/strong>: High\u2011gradient <strong>permanent powder magnetic separators<\/strong> at several points in the process: raw material, milling, classification, and final packaging.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.imt-inc.com\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-explained\/\" target=\"_blank\">imt-inc<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"1581\" height=\"891\" src=\"https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014500325.jpg\" alt=\"Magnetic Separator Selection Steps\" class=\"wp-image-3069\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014500325.jpg 1581w, https:\/\/www.wdymagnetic.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/2026052014500325-18x10.jpg 18w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1581px) 100vw, 1581px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"Common-Mistakes-to-Avoid\"><\/a><strong>Common Mistakes to Avoid<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>From field audits and troubleshooting visits, three mistakes recur: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>Overspecifying magnet strength without considering flow dynamics<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Simply choosing the strongest magnet does not guarantee better separation. If the housing design promotes bypass channels or dead zones, metal will still escape.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/experts.umn.edu\/en\/publications\/particle-flow-modeling-of-dry-induced-roll-magnetic-separator\/\" target=\"_blank\">experts.umn<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Ignoring cleanability and access<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Magnets that are difficult to inspect and clean will not be maintained properly, especially in busy plants. This leads to gradual performance drift that is hard to detect.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.magnattackglobal.com\/blog\/bakery-magnet-guide\/\" target=\"_blank\">magnattackglobal<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3. <strong>Treating magnets as standalone devices<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Magnetic separators are most effective as part of a <strong>layered contamination control strategy<\/strong> with screens, metal detectors, and process controls. Your magnet type and placement should align with upstream and downstream equipment.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/elcanindustries.com\/toll-processing\/top-magnetic-separator-manufacturers-and-suppliers-in-the-usa\/\" target=\"_blank\">elcanindustries<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"FAQs\"><\/a><strong>FAQs<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"FAQ-1:-How-do-I-know-if-I-need-an-electromagnetic-separator-instead-of-a-permanent-one?\"><\/a><strong>FAQ 1: How do I know if I need an electromagnetic separator instead of a permanent one?<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Electromagnetic separators are preferred when you handle <strong>wet slurries, high throughput, and variable ore or feed conditions<\/strong>, and you need to fine\u2011tune field strength for different products. If your process is dry, stable, and energy efficiency is a priority, a high\u2011intensity permanent separator is usually the better starting point.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.gme-magnet.com\/info\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-trends-insights-102868358.html\" target=\"_blank\">gme-magnet<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"FAQ-2:-How-often-should-industrial-magnets-be-inspected-or-tested?\"><\/a><strong>FAQ 2: How often should industrial magnets be inspected or tested?<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Most plants benefit from <strong>quarterly performance checks<\/strong> and at least <strong>annual pull\u2011test verification<\/strong>, aligning with food safety and quality audit practices. Inspection frequency should increase where contamination risk is high or customer specifications are especially tight.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.magnattackglobal.com\/blog\/bakery-magnet-guide\/\" target=\"_blank\">magnattackglobal<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"FAQ-3:-Can-permanent-magnets-lose-strength-over-time?\"><\/a><strong>FAQ 3: Can permanent magnets lose strength over time?<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Yes, but with modern rare\u2011earth materials and normal operating temperatures, loss is usually <strong>very slow<\/strong> and often negligible over many years. Abrasive wear, mechanical shock, and excessive heat are the most common causes of noticeable demagnetization in industrial settings.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.greatmagtech.com\/info\/magnetic-separators-principles-and-everyday-a-92499023.html\" target=\"_blank\">greatmagtech<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"FAQ-4:-What-is-the-environmental-impact-of-using-rare\u2011earth-permanent-magnets?\"><\/a><strong>FAQ 4: What is the environmental impact of using rare\u2011earth permanent magnets?<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>The main environmental footprint comes from <strong>mining and refining rare\u2011earth elements<\/strong>, which must be managed responsibly. However, because permanent magnets operate without power, they can reduce overall plant energy use compared with large electromagnets, partially offsetting that footprint. [<a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.gme-magnet.com\/info\/wet-drum-magnetic-separators-trends-insights-102868358.html\" target=\"_blank\">gme-magnet<\/a>]<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a id=\"FAQ-5:-Where-should-I-install-magnetic-separators-in-an-existing-line?\"><\/a><strong>FAQ 5: Where should I install magnetic separators in an existing line?<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Prioritize <strong>early in the process<\/strong> to protect critical equipment and <strong>just before final packaging<\/strong> to protect product quality and end\u2011user safety. Additional magnets may be justified before high\u2011value or sensitive unit operations such as milling, classification, or coating.
